## Runbook: Donation-Receipt Mailer (Heartvale)

The mailer batches receipts every hour, rendering templates from the Heartvale ledger export. If a batch fails, inspect the render log before retrying — duplicate sends are irreversible and donors notice. Retries must use the same batch token so the dedupe guard holds. For the sync: note that the mailer now talks to the relay over the authenticated channel, whose credential is set directly below.

sealed setting: COURIER_KEY29=170ad45524657711572101e080d15

Changed defaults in Splitfork, our assignment service. Bucketing now uses sticky hashing per account instead of per session, and the holdout slice grew from 2% to 5%. Callers relying on session-level reassignment must opt in explicitly. Review the diff against the new baseline; the updated default configuration is listed below.

config for tagep-kajof:
[casir]
port = 6379
region = south-1
host = casir.paliqdyn.example
team = tamax
timeout_ms = 250
retries = 2

Schema migrations on the Larkspur platform must be zero-downtime, which means every change ships in at least two phases: expand first (add columns, backfill, dual-write), then contract (drop old paths) only after the prior release is fully rolled out. Never combine expand and contract in one deploy, and never rename a column in place. The migration tool enforces most of this, but it can't catch logical dual-write bugs. The phase-by-phase checklist, with examples, is on the internal migrations page.

wiki page, hahif-hahif: https://argocd.kelvisys.corp/browse/board/settings/pages/1442e0b1065d83f1

## Data stores — Croneva migration

All legacy cron jobs moved to the Croneva workflow engine last quarter. Croneva persists run history, schedules, and secrets references (not secret values) in a single Postgres instance, encrypted at rest, network-restricted to the worker subnet. Audit logs retained 90 days. The engine connects to its store via the string below.

replica DSN, kajep-yahag: mssql://praok_svc:iF@db-8d68.plorvaio.local:5432/eliion

## Limits & Quotas: Planner Regression (Quartzbase 4.2)

Heads up — the 4.2 planner sometimes picks nested-loop joins on big fact tables, blowing past the query timeout. We've capped a few knobs as a stopgap until the fix lands. If you're on call and see timeout spikes, check these first. Current clamped values are:

tuning constants:
TIERS = {
    "sorion": 670,
    "istax": 547,
}